S1 form husband details have been sent to us . by Kath948381

I've got my S1 but husband's just received his details to be hopefully be added to mine then we can register with a GP. So what do we need to take with us to get him added to my form ? I'm a pensioner he isn't but he does have major heart problems.

tutisservis

Both of you should have your own S1 form, his will obviously be as a dependent but will still be a certificate under his name. Then, you go to the National Health Insurance Fund department to register the certificates and put yourselves in the BG ... Read More
